Genetics have a substantial impact on metabolic rate and the way the body consumes nutrition and energy. Variations in metabolism-related genes can alter basal metabolic rate (BMR), fat accumulation, and sensitivity to dietary treatments. Others may have genetic predispositions that make them more prone to weight gain or metabolic issues.

Furthermore, heredity might affect how the body reacts to certain food components, such as carbs or fats. For example, certain gene variations may affect insulin sensitivity or lipid metabolism, influencing how efficiently the body consumes and stores these nutrients. Understanding an individual's genetic predispositions can assist personalize dietary and lifestyle therapies to improve metabolic health and reduce the risk of obesity or metabolic disorders. While genetics may incline people to specific metabolic features, lifestyle choices such as food, physical activity, and sleep still have a significant impact on overall metabolic health.
